Seeking a Systems Analyst (internally referred to as SAS Programmer) to Create, maintain and test code used for non-standard data file creation as well as for CDISC SDTM and ADaM datasets; mentor System Analyst I staff; programming resource for Clinical Data Operations staff and other departments as needed including creation of statistical and submission-ready datasets.

 

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:

  • Attend client meetings as appropriate to understand data collection requirements for the protocol.

  • Receive and review standard Clario/non-Clario standard client file specifications from Data Manager/Project Manager or client and interact with the client to finalize transfer specifications.

  • Develop and validate programs to create non-standard data files as well as CDISC SDTM and ADaM compliant datasets.

  • Create submission-ready datasets for cardiac safety trials (SDTM EG and ADaM ADEG) including define.xml and dataset reviewers guides for FDA submissions.

  • As part of the Software Development Life Cycle, develop and unit test code, create and execute test scripts and perform peer review.

  • Process data extracts, review encoding requests daily to run encoding programs and archive studies.

  • Performing ad-hoc programming activities utilizing raw data based on internal and external requests for:

    • Esoteric quality control checks. 

    • Data resolution/mining.

    • Treatment emergent flags and other specifications per Statistical Analysis Plan.

    • Other client requirements.

  • Work with data management in providing programming support for DM activities including data review.

  • Prepare and participate in internal and external audits.

  • Work across multiple service lines and modalities.

  • Work hand in hand with a cross functional teams (Cardiologists, Data Managers, Project Managers and other industry experts) for project delivery  - for example to support New Product Initiatives and Minimum Viable Product solutions.

  • Identify opportunities to improve the methodology and provide practical solutions for problems.

  • Contribute to the development of best practice to improve quality, efficiency and effectiveness.
